When selecting polypropylene spinning machines, the first step is not to focus on the configuration, but to match the machine to the specific application.

During actual communication, we have noticed that the requirements expressed by the purchasers are often similar, but the downstream fields served by the equipment are significantly different. Therefore, the first step in selection is to clearly define the application scenarios of your own.


Even for polypropylene fibers, those used for making webbing and those for making carpets, the indicators they care about vary greatly; those making luggage fabric and those making geotextiles have completely different suitable machine models. Therefore, the first step in selection is not to compare configurations, but to first categorize yourself into one of the following categories.


First category: Stable production type - targeted at regular polypropylene long fibers, focus on "one-step" efficiency

Typical downstream applications: webbing, luggage straps, safety belts, ropes, carpet facings, outdoor fabrics, filtration materials.


Recommended path: For such products, using polypropylene FDY spinning machines (one-step spinning and stretching) is the most straightforward. The spinning and stretching are integrated into one line, the process is short, and the space occupation is small. The finished fibers can directly enter the weaving or knitting process. Such orders are usually batch production, with relatively fixed colors, and often use liquid dyeing (color mother addition), with no post-dyeing, and the delivery date and cost can be easily controlled.


The three "invisible life-and-death lines" to focus on during selection:

Rolling and forming stability - directly determines the breakage rate of the post-drawing process;

Rolling tube performance - the silent killer affecting weaving efficiency;

Whether it is convenient to change colors and varieties - seemingly insignificant, but it is the most frustrating part every day.

Passing these three tests, batch orders can run smoothly and last longer.


Second category: Flexible change type - for diverse products and raw materials, calculate the "switching cost"

Typical pain points: Many colors of orders, wide fiber fineness range, and frequent changes of varieties every three to five days.

Selection core thinking: Don't just focus on the designed production capacity, but also ask more about the flexibility of the equipment.

What is the range of adaptability of the screw and metering pump?

Can the spinning components be used for different specifications?

Is it troublesome to change the winding head specifications?

The answers to these questions directly determine how much downtime and transition fibers you need to waste, how much labor you need to consume each time you change varieties. For such customers, the "flexibility" of the equipment is more valuable than the "rigidity" of production capacity. A machine that is easy to change varieties can save a lot of waste and downtime in the initial equipment cost, which can recover the initial equipment price difference in a year.


Third category: Recycled differentiation type - using recycled bottle pieces or extended polyester industrial fibers, the front process must be well done

If you plan to use recycled bottle pieces or your products are extended towards polyester POY or polyester industrial fibers, then the focus should start from the drying and filtering processes in the front stage.

The impurity content of recycled materials fluctuates greatly, and the requirements for filtration accuracy and uniform plasticization are extremely high. If the filtration and plasticization cannot keep up, the spinning state is not easy to stabilize - floating fibers, breakage, and fine fibers occur frequently, and even the most powerful machine is useless. At this time, increasing the filtration area and designing an additional homogenization section is more important than simply increasing the screw rotation speed. This initial configuration investment can help you avoid 80% or more of production abnormalities in the later stage.
